Edmund A. Murphy is a scholar working on Atmospheric Science, Global and Planetary Change and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. According to data from OpenAlex, Edmund A. Murphy has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 342 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Atmospheric Science, 6 papers in Global and Planetary Change and 4 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in Edmund A. Murphy's work include Meteorological Phenomena and Simulations (7 papers), Atmospheric aerosols and clouds (5 papers) and Adaptive optics and wavefront sensing (4 papers). Edmund A. Murphy is often cited by papers focused on Meteorological Phenomena and Simulations (7 papers), Atmospheric aerosols and clouds (5 papers) and Adaptive optics and wavefront sensing (4 papers). Edmund A. Murphy collaborates with scholars based in United States, France and Canada. Edmund A. Murphy's co-authors include Marian A. Packham, James F. Mustard, Geoffrey M. Evans, Edward E. Nishizawa, Caroline Bedell Thomas, Florian Zink, R. A. Vincent, J. Vernin, Owen R. Coté and Anthony J. Ratkowski and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Experimental Medicine,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res and Annals of the New York Academy of Sciences.
